-- Film critic KARINA LONGWORTH, author of the new illustrated book "Meryl Streep: Anatomy of an Actor", speaks to the unparalleled career of the 18-time Oscar-nominated actress (and three-time winner). This book is the first lengthy study of the actress as a feminist artist, as Longworth argues that Streep's choice of roles, her process and the results are actually quite radical. She says her body of work functions as a kind of alternative history of the 20th century from a female perspective.
-- Toronto-raised rapper DRAKE has gone from being an outcast at his hometown high school, to a successful teen TV actor, and now -- at age 26 -- a hugely-successful rapper whose confessional, vulnerable lyrical style is matched in force by his confidence and bravado as a performer and celebrity. Jian talks to him in this wide-ranging two part feature interview.
